Shawn Ramsey wrote:
> 
> > I know alot of people subscribe to this list
> > so i am gonna ask a slightly off question.
> >
> > Does anyone know of a manufacturer that
> > makes a socket7 motherboard with onboard
> > scsi that i can run freeBSD on.
> >
> > I hate to pay a fortune for those
> > scsi cards and pentium chips.
> 
> There probably is, but I would say just get a SCSI card. Not all SCSI
> adapters cost a fortune. Get a one of the Symbios 53C8X based cards, they
> work well and are pretty cheap. The only experience I have with these, is a
> Tekram 390F which has worked great so far, and only cost $80.
> 

Ditto Diamond Fireport cards
